The Market Navigator turns the methodology taught in Market School by Investors Business Daily into an easy-to-use indicator. This system follows a strict set of rules to help gauge when it's time to increase market exposure or back away.

The indicator considers 24 different buy and sell signals, as well as portfolio management rules, to keep you on the right side of the market with no guesswork.

Buy and sell signals are generated based on different criteria, including the relationship between price and key moving averages, volume, and time. Each signal is assigned a point value, which is then added (buy signal) or subtracted (sell signal) to the running exposure count when the signal occurs. This exposure count is then used to give a recommended maximum exposure level.

The Market Navigator also identifies certain instances when being more aggressive is called for, known as a Power Trend. A Power Trend is triggered within the context of an uptrend that meets a certain criterion of price, length, and moving average relationship.

Dynamic Day 1
When you first put the indicator on your chart, it will ask you to select Day 1 of the current rally attempt. A Day 1 is defined as either:
  • The first positive day in a down trending market
  • A down day where the index closes in the upper half of the daily range

Added ability for volatility adjusted follow through days. The reference table will now also display the current volatility and % gain needed for a volatility adjusted follow through day based on the parameters below.

  • Volatility defined as the average percentage gain of the up days over the prior 200 days.
  • Volatility less than or equal to 0.4%, follow-through must close up 0.7% or higher.
    
  • Volatility greater than or equal to 0.4% and less than 0.55%, follow-through must close up 0.85% or higher.
  • Volatility greater than or equal to 0.55% and less than 1.00%, follow-through must close up 1.00% or higher.
    
  • Volatility greater than or equal to 1.00%, follow-through must close up 1.245% or higher.

The Market Navigator now includes the option to turn on or off the 95% rule.

The 95% rule was not talked about in the original Market School course but was later added as a rule for stall days. With the rule turned on, when stalling action occurs and volume is within 95% of the previous days volume, it will be counted as a stall day.

If the 95% rule is turned off, higher volume than the previous day will be required for stall days.
